Output 80240c662f69ce0c59b53b424bcdfd04fbfb2062d4e5c1e55bbc56f703b3a186:0

value
155849
script pubkey
OP_0 OP_PUSHBYTES_20 5fb68fc9aef2dd54141fc3482909bdfa88db87e3
address
bc1qt7mgljdw7tw4g9qlcdyzjzdal2ydhplrjxh77a
transaction
80240c662f69ce0c59b53b424bcdfd04fbfb2062d4e5c1e55bbc56f703b3a186
confirmations
58994
spent
true